Hyperion has again been named the number one provider of multidimensional analysis/OLAP technology, based on worldwide 2001 software licence and maintenance revenues. This is according to the latest report from analyst company IDC. Hyperion beat a number of competitors to come in first again this year in a category it pioneered.

Hyperion invented OLAP technology and continues to feature the technology in its market-leading Hyperion Essbase XTD business intelligence platform. Hyperion Essbase XTD is an essential element of Hyperion`s Business Performance Management Suite, which customers are using continuously to measure performance, drive growth and profitability and anticipate where their business is going.
